A Single Girder I‑Beam Type EOT Crane is a kind of overhead crane wherein: The crane has one main bridge girder (beam) rather than two (as in double girder cranes). The girder is of the I‑beam section (often rolled, though sometimes fabricated) rather than a box girder or lattice. A hoist (wire rope or chain) is mounted on a trolley that travels along this single I‑beam. The bridge (girder + end carriages) travels on runway rails mounted on supports above the working area. This design is common for light to medium duty lifting, moderate spans/heights, where cost, headroom, simplicity, and lighter infrastructure loads are significant considerations.
